Meanwhile, in washington tomorrow, we may learn more about the mueller investigations are a kind of status tomorrow, because tomorrow will bring the first real sentencing in the vex. Alexander vander zwann who worked with Paul Manafort and rick gates in ukraine has pled guilty to lie with investigators. Last week he revealed about communications with gates and a person with ties to the russian government and it was relevant to the russia investigation. And the wall street journal reports that russobert mueller looking into roger stones 2016 claim he had met with Julian Assange. In an email dated august 4, 2016, mr. Stone wrote, i dined with Julian Assange last night. The next day mr. Stone publicly praised mr. Assange via twitter. Mr. Muellers team has asked about mr. Stones email during testimony before a grand jury, according to the person familiar with the matter. Stone tone the journal that the email to sam nunberg was, quote, a joke, but he has frequently claimed some kind of contact with wikileaks and then issued a denial. Whats the chance in some sort of sentencing statement were going to learn more about kind of a status check where they are on the timeline . I think that thats pretty unlikely. What well see tomorrow is the first real sentencing in this investigation. Its van der zwann. We know he doesnt have a Cooperation Agreement with mueller. Everything has to be on writing in the guilty play plae. Gaty pleas maintain this routine language that say im not relying on anything other than what is in this document. We do know he has turned over some key pieces of evidence to mueller. Hes turned over tapes of conversation, hes turned over emails. Weve heard that muellers team did not have that before. His value is that even without cooperation, he could be compelled to testify at trial if needed since hell have no fifth amendment privilege, no reason he would incriminate himself if he testified after he is sentenced tomorrow. Hes available as a witness. Whether we learn anything new at sentencing i think is unlikely with this caveat, if there is any sort of quibbling about what his conduct was and what kind of sentence he should get, then we may hear some details from Andrew Weisman on muellers team who is handling the sentencing. We may get a little more insight into what van der zwaan did. More like a couple years with roger stone. The most interesting thing about roger stone in in investigation is he has not talked to mueller. Federal prosecutors look at three categories of people, witnesses, subjects, someone whose conduct is within the scope of the investigation and then a target, someone that prosecutors plan on indicting. Typically you dont interview targets. So draw your own conclusions on stone. Mr. Crowley, if joe digenova and toensing are i guess the preds gets to have these two as counsel just in another way.
